Specific migration of mineral oil (MOSH/POSH and MOAH) into 95% ethanol
Specific migration of mineral oil hydrocarbons (MOH), including mineral oil saturated hydrocarbons (MOSH) with polyolefin oligomeric hydrocarbons (POSH) and mineral oil aromatic hydrocarbons (MOAH) from food contact materials (FCM) into the food simulant D2e (95% ethanol).
The results are reported as the concentrations of groups of MOSH/POSH and MOAH. The groups are formed based on the number of carbons in substances and the reporting unit is mg of MOSH/POSH or MOAH per dm2 of FCM or mg of MOSH/POSH or MOAH per kg of food simulant. Additionally, the result includes the sum amounts of all MOSH/POSH and MOAH together with the total amount of MOH (MOSH + MOAH).
The POSH are not part of MOH but can be present in polyolefin plastics, such as polyethylene (PE) and polypropylene (PP). MOSH and POSH have very similar structures and they tend to elute together in chromatography. Thus in polyolefin plastics and materials with polyolefin layers, it is usually impossible to separate MOSH and POSH with normal analysis techniques.
